您的位置:首页 > 编程语言 > C#

C# winform form之间传值(本人亲测)(2)

2016-03-18 16:53 501 查看
一、父窗体向子窗体传值



父窗体中代码:

private void btn_father_Click(object sender, EventArgs e)
{
Child child = new Child();
child.child_text = tb_father.Text;
child.ShowDialog();
}


子窗体中代码:

public string child_text { get; set; }

private void btn_child_Click(object sender, EventArgs e)
{
child_text = tb_child.Text;
this.Close();
}

private void Child_Load(object sender, EventArgs e)
{
tb_child.Text = child_text;
}


二、子窗体向父窗体传值



父窗体中代码:

<span style="font-size:24px;"> private void btn_father_Click(object sender, EventArgs e)
{
Child child = new Child();
child.ShowDialog();
tb_father.Text = child.child_text;
}</span>


子窗体中代码:

<span style="font-size:24px;"> public string child_text { get; set; }

private void btn_child_Click(object sender, EventArgs e)
{
child_text = tb_child.Text;
this.Close();
}</span>
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  winform form间传值